Solve <br> 5x+4+8x-3=79 ???
sammy [17]

Answer:

x=6

Step-by-step explanation:

5x+4+8x-3=79

=>13x=79-4+3

=>13x=78

=>x=78/13

=>x=6

A quantity with an initial value of 600 decays exponentially at a rate of
Snowcat [4.5K]

Answer:

The value of the quantity after 87 months will be of 599.64.

Step-by-step explanation:

A quantity with an initial value of 600 decays exponentially at a rate of 0.05% every 6 years.

This means that the quantity, after t periods of 6 years, is given by:

Q(t) = 600(1 - 0.0005)^{t}

What is the value of the quantity after 87 months, to the nearest hundredth?

6 years = 6*12 = 72 months

So 87 months is 87/72 = 1.2083 periods of 6 years. So we have to find Q(1.2083).

Q(t) = 600(1 - 0.0005)^{t}

Q(1.2083) = 600(1 - 0.0005)^{1.2083} = 599.64

The value of the quantity after 87 months will be of 599.64.
